Car
From any location in Lanaudière, get onto Autoroute 25 South towards Montreal. Continue on Autoroute 25, then take the exit towards Autoroute 720 West. Follow the signs for 'Centre Ville' and merge onto Autoroute 720. Continue until you reach the exit for 'Notre-Dame Street'. Merge onto Notre-Dame Street, and you will find access to the Lachine Canal area. There are several parking lots along the canal, but be prepared to pay for parking, typically around CAD 2 to CAD 5 per hour.
Public Transportation
If you prefer to use public transportation, start by taking a bus from your location in Lanaudière to the nearest train station. The best option is to take a bus to the 'Candiac' or 'Delson' train stations. From there, take the AMT (Montreal's commuter train service) towards Montreal. Get off at the 'Lucien L'Allier' station. Once you arrive, transfer to the Metro Orange Line and travel towards Côte-Vertu. Get off at the 'Bonaventure' station. From here, you can walk approximately 15 minutes to the Lachine Canal. Note that train and Metro fares will vary, typically around CAD 4.50 for a single fare.
Bike
For a more active approach, consider biking to the Lachine Canal. If you're starting in Lanaudière, you can bike along the Route Verte (Green Route) which connects various regions in Quebec. Head towards Montreal and follow the designated bike paths to reach the canal. Once you arrive, there are bike rental facilities available nearby if you need. Keep in mind that you may want to bring your own bike lock for security. There are no additional costs if you already have a bike.
